The collapse of peace negotiations between the United States and Iran has introduced a new wave of uncertainty into global energy markets, with analysts warning that oil prices could rise sharply in the coming months.

The talks, held in Islamabad, were widely seen as a last opportunity to stabilize the region and protect critical energy supply routes. Their failure has shifted attention back to the risks associated with escalating conflict.

Immediate Market Reaction

Following news of the failed talks, oil prices showed signs of upward pressure as traders reacted to the possibility of supply disruptions. Markets are highly sensitive to geopolitical developments, particularly in regions that play a central role in energy production.

Investors are now closely monitoring developments in the Strait of Hormuz, where any disruption could have immediate consequences for supply chains.

Key Drivers of Price Volatility

1. Supply Chain Vulnerability

The Middle East remains one of the world’s most important oil-producing regions. Any instability in this area can disrupt production or transportation.

2. Shipping and Insurance Costs

Shipping companies are already facing increased costs due to heightened risk in the region. Insurance premiums for oil tankers have risen, contributing to overall price increases.

3. Speculation and Market Sentiment

Uncertainty often leads to speculative trading, which can amplify price fluctuations.

Broader Economic Impact

Rising oil prices have a cascading effect on the global economy:

  • Increased fuel costs for consumers
  • Higher transportation expenses
  • Pressure on inflation rates

Industries such as aviation, logistics, and manufacturing are particularly vulnerable to sustained price increases.

Long-Term Outlook

If diplomatic efforts fail to resume, analysts warn that oil prices could remain volatile throughout 2026. Prolonged instability may also encourage countries to seek alternative energy sources or diversify supply chains.

Conclusion

The Iran conflict has once again demonstrated the fragile nature of global energy markets.

Without a clear diplomatic resolution, oil prices are likely to remain under pressure, affecting economies worldwide.
